It's That Time Again

This is the week the sports calendar flips -- less than 10 days after the Super Bowl, baseball players begin reporting to training camps in Florida and Arizona.

Can you believe that 25 years ago, reporters didn't watch Grapefruit League games from the press box, but from foul territory in right field just past the grandstand of the small and simple ballparks (in this case, Clearwater's old Jack Russell Stadium)?

As an industry, spring training has mushroomed in size, the close-up intimacy reporters enjoyed in the 1980s replaced by massive campuses with less direct access to the players and more distance from the games.
